Property Description

This lush, wooded 6 Acre lot in the quiet Hideaway Harbor subdivision comes with an additional 0.5 Acre waterfront lot on boat-navigable Patsaliga Creek. The wide creek meanders through the wetlands and into Andalusia’s Point A Lake, a 600 Acre reservoir on the Conecuh River. These scenic, spacious waterways are fantastic for fishing, watersports, boating, and swimming.

The versatility of this natural residential lot offers a natural canvas to build your dream home. Tuck it back among the trees for a shaded woodland retreat, or clear away the underbrush for an eye-catching tree-lined drive to showcase your home.

The 0.5 Acre waterfront lot is ideal for a dock, seating area/gazebo, firepit, and BBQ pit, where you can enjoy the slower pace of riverside life. Catch spectacular sunsets, watch boats glide by, and drop a line for abundant sunfish, catfish, and spotted bass that swim the creek.

The possibilities for building, recreation, and relaxing are endless, and Hideaway Harbor’s detailed covenants ensure it remains a valuable, beautiful natural haven for all residents.  

Access & Utilities

These parcels are sold together and may not be purchased or sold separately. Both parcels lie along paved Harbor Road, about half a mile apart, with access to utilities and city water. View Hideaway Harbor covenants and restrictions here.

Hideaway Harbor is conveniently located between Route 29, AL-55, I-65, and US-84, all less than 10 minutes away.

Andalusia is 15 minutes from the subdivision, where you’ll find a Walmart, CVS, Piggly Wiggly, Dollar stores, the Andalusia Health Center, and home, auto, and supply centers.

Outdoor Recreation

South Alabama’s mix of woodlands and wetlands offers a breathtaking playground of adventure and wildlife experiences. Covington County, where this subdivision is located, boasts several recreational destinations, including Point A Reservoir and Gantt Lake (the lakes are accessible via Patsaliga Creek), Lake Frank Jackson & Jackson State Park, and Conecuh National Forest.

Each location has unique experiences to offer:

The lot connects to a long chain of connected waterways. Passing through Point A along the Conecuh River, you can also travel by boat to Gantt Lake, the largest freshwater lake in south Alabama, and a hydroelectric generating dam. Gantt Lake is a captivating Alabama attraction, offering pristine waters that stretch over 2,700 acres as an ideal spot for boating, fishing, and watersports. Anglers of all ages will have fun fishing for redear, largemouth bass, bluegill, and white crappie.

Frank Jackson State Park is a gem for nature enthusiasts. Frank Jackson State Park in Opp, Alabama, combines diverse wildlife, abundant hiking trails, and panoramic lake views. Highlights include a pristine 1,000-acre lake for fishing and boating, a scenic boardwalk, and well-maintained camping facilities. Bream, channel catfish, crappy, and largemouth bass are the primary species for anglers at this lake.

Spanning 83,000 acres, the Conecuh National Forest is a jewel of Alabama's natural heritage. Offering an array of outdoor activities such as hiking trails, hunting zones, and fishing spots, it serves as a sanctuary of tranquility and an adventure playground for eco-tourists.

Named for its tannin-stained waters and soft, sandy-bottomed river, Blackwater River State Park in Holt, Florida, is a picturesque haven for outdoor enthusiasts. This serene destination offers canoeing, tubing, and swimming opportunities, as well as nature trails that meander through Florida's unique ecosystem.

While in sunny Florida, spend a day on the white sands of Destin, Florida. Relax and breathe in the salty sea breeze blowing over the turquoise surf. Destin is less than 2 hours from Hideaway Harbor!

Straddling the Alabama-Georgia border, the 45,000-acre Walter F. George Reservoir (also known as Lake Eufaula) boasts 640 miles of picturesque shoreline. This aquatic playground offers world-class fishing, boating, and water sports opportunities. Its surrounding areas are dotted with quaint cottages and vacation homes, making it fit for a painting. The rich biodiversity and captivating vistas make it a must-visit attraction in the region.

Hunting & Wildlife Viewing in South Alabama

South Alabama is a prime hunting region for big and small game, upland birds, and waterfowl. Uniquely, hunting is possible every month of the year for at least one species in Alabama. Large game includes white-tailed deer, feral hogs, and alligators. Fowl include wild turkey, sandhill crane, Bobwhite quail, mourning dove, and waterfowl.

Note: the black bear population is growing, but hunting black bears in Alabama is illegal.

20 Wooded Mountain Acres bordering nearly 300,000 Acres of the Cibola National Forest less than 1 mile from "The Falls" waterfall.

This parcel borders the Cibola National Forest along the West boundary and is covered with dense mature Ponderosa Pines.

There is seasonal water flow running through the entire Eastern portion of the property.

This beautiful forest property offers varying terrain, with the peak elevation on the Western portion near the Cibola National Forest reaching 7,640 feet. This is among one of the highest points in the area, comparable with the 7,700 foot Mesa located 4 miles South.

Bordering the Cibola National Forest comes with opportunity for extended recreation right from the property. The seasonal water flow also offers a source of water for the wildlife residing in the forest. See photos for the many wildlife tracks & droppings found on the property. 

Located in Game Management Unit 10, which is said to be desirable for Mule Deer & Elk with some of largest Bulls in New Mexico. (Download the GMU 10 Map)

For more information, visit the New Mexico Game & Fish Department Website.

The richly diverse volcanic landscape of El Malpais National Park offers solitude, recreation, and discovery. Explore cinder cones, lava tube caves, sandstone bluffs, caves and hiking trails. Wildlife abounds in the open grasslands and forests.

The property is 8.7 miles to State Highway 53 which will take you directly to San Rafael to the East, then connects to I-40 to take you into Grants and Milan.

The city of Gallup is located 52 miles from the property. There is a Walmart Supercenter, various parks, professional services, medical centers, groceries, and supplies located here. The population of Gallup, New Mexico is about 21,700.

Grants, New Mexico is also located only 61 miles East, which has a population of around 10,000 people. In Grants you will find groceries, supplies, the Cibola General Hospital, an airport and Walmart Supercenter.

Utility Lines are in the area and on nearby developed properties where land owners have homes, mobile homes, cabins, accessory buildings and corrals (see photos & satellite images).
